Immersive Interactive Telepresence
US-2017251181-A1 · Aug 31, 2017 · US
US9990775B2 · US · B2
| Field | Value |
|---|---|
| Publication number | US-9990775-B2 |
| Application number | US-201615087891-A |
| Country | US |
| Kind code | B2 |
| Filing date | Mar 31, 2016 |
| Priority date | Mar 31, 2016 |
| Publication date | Jun 5, 2018 |
| Grant date | Jun 5, 2018 |
A practical reading order for non-experts. Skip the full description unless you need deep technical detail.
What the patent document calls the invention.
A short plain-language summary of the technical disclosure.
Who owns or filed the patent and who is credited as inventor.
Filing, priority, publication, and grant dates set the timeline.
The legal scope of protection — read this for what is actually claimed.
Technology tags used to group this patent with similar filings.
Prior art links and similar publications in this corpus.
Official abstract text for this publication.
An exemplary interactive media content provider system generates overall data representative of interactive media content. The exemplary interactive media content provider system concurrently provides the overall data to both a first media player device associated with a first user and a second media player device associated with a second user by way of a point-to-multipoint media delivery protocol. The first media player device and the second media player device may each be configured to render different portions of the overall data to respective display screens of the media player devices at a particular point in time based on different user input from the first user and the second user, respectively, as the first user and the second user independently interact with the interactive media content. Corresponding methods and systems are also described.
Opening claim text (preview).
What is claimed is: 1. A method comprising: generating, by an interactive media content provider system, overall data representative of an immersive virtual reality world, the overall data including a plurality of different content files each including data representative of content of the immersive virtual reality world, the plurality of different content files comprising at least one of: a plurality of uniform-resolution content files that are each encoded in a uniform resolution, are each associated with a different respective center point within the immersive virtual reality world, and each comprise data representative of a different view of the immersive virtual reality world corresponding to the respective center point of each uniform-resolution content file, and a plurality of mixed-resolution content files that each correspond to one respective content sector of a plurality of partially overlapping content sectors that together form a view of the immersive virtual reality world corresponding to a single center point, and that each comprise data representative of the plurality of partially overlapping content sectors in which the one respective content sector is encoded in a high resolution and in which a remainder of the content sectors are encoded in a low resolution lower than the high resolution; and concurrently providing, by the interactive media content provider system by way of a point-to-multipoint media delivery protocol, the overall data to both: a first media player device associated with a first user, the first media player device configured to render a first portion of the overall data within a first field of view presented on a display screen of the first media player device, the first field of view including content of a first observed area of the immersive virtual reality world to which the first user directs the first field of view, and a second media player device associated with a second user, the second media player device configured to render a second portion of the overall data within a second field of view presented on a display screen of the second media player device, the second field of view including content of a second observed area of the immersive virtual reality world to which the second user directs the second field of view; wherein the first portion of the overall data dynamically changes to continually correspond to the first observed area as the first user experiences the immersive virtual reality world, the second portion of the overall data dynamically changes to continually correspond to the second observed area as the second user experiences the immersive virtual reality world, and the first field of view and the second field of view are independently directed by the first user and the second user, respectively, such that, at a particular point in time, the first portion of the overall data rendered within the first field of view is included within a first content file within the plurality of different content files and is different from the second portion of the overall data rendered within the second field of view and included within a second content file within the plurality of different content files. 2. The method of claim 1 , further comprising receiving, by the interactive media content provider system, data representative of camera-captured real-world scenery, the data representative of the camera-captured real-world scenery captured by a video camera arranged to capture a 360-degree image of the real-world scenery around a center point corresponding to the video camera; wherein the overall data is generated based on the received data representative of the camera-captured real-world scenery. 3. The method of claim 1 , wherein: the first field of view is directed to the first observed area of the immersive virtual reality world based on an alignment of a spatial orientation of the display screen of the first media player device with the first observed area; and the second field of view is directed to the second observed area of the immersive virtual reality world based on an alignment of a spatial orientation of the display screen of the second media player device with the second observed area. 4. The method of claim 1 , wherein the plurality of different content files included in the overall data includes the plurality of uniform-resolution content files. 5. The method of claim 4 , wherein: the first content file that includes the first portion of the overall data rendered within the first field of view at the particular point in time comprises a first uniform-resolution content file associated with a first center point within the immersive virtual reality world; and the second content file that includes the second portion of the overall data rendered within the second field of view at the particular point in time comprises a second uniform-resolution content file associated with a second center point within the immersive virtual reality world. 6. The method of claim 1 , wherein: the plurality of different content files included in the overall data includes the plurality of mixed-resolution content files; the first content file that includes the first portion of the overall data rendered within the first field of view at the particular point in time comprises a first mixed-resolution content file corresponding to a first content sector of the plurality of partially overlapping content sectors; and the second content file that includes the second portion of the overall data rendered within the second field of view at the particular point in time comprises a second mixed-resolution content file corresponding to a second content sector of the plurality of partially overlapping content sectors. 7. The method of claim 6 , wherein at least one content sector from the remainder of the content sectors is encoded in a first low resolution lower than the high resolution and at least one other content sector from the remainder of the content sectors is encoded in a second low resolution lower than the high resolution and lower than the first low resolution. 8. The method of claim 6 , wherein: the view of the immersive virtual reality world is represented as a spherical structure around the single center point within the plurality of mixed-resolution content files included within the overall data; and each content sector in the plurality of partially overlapping content sectors is a circular image depicting content from a sector of the immersive virtual reality world. 9. The method of claim 1 , wherein the point-to-multipoint media delivery protocol is a Multimedia Broadcast Multicast Service protocol performed using a Long-Term Evolution wireless platform. 10. The method of claim 1 , embodied as computer-executable instructions on at least one non-transitory computer-readable medium. 11. A method comprising: generating, by an interactive media content provider system, overall data representative of an immersive virtual reality world and including a plurality of mixed-resolution content files that each correspond to one respective content sector of a plurality of partially overlapping content sectors that together form a view of the immersive virtual reality world corresponding to a single center point, and each comprise data representative of the plurality of partially overlapping content sectors in which the one respective content sector is encoded in a high resolution and in which a remainder of the content sectors are encoded in a low resolution lower than the high resolution; and concurrently providing, by the interactive media content provider system by way of a point-to-multipoint media delivery protocol, the overall data to both:
involving transmission via a mobile phone network (wireless downlink channel access H04W74/006) · CPC title
embedded in a portable device, e.g. video client on a mobile phone, PDA, laptop (constructional details of equipment or arrangements specially adapted for portable computer application G06F1/1626; arrangements specially adapted for mobile receivers in broadcast systems H04H20/57) · CPC title
Perspective computation · CPC title
Cameras (H04N23/00 takes precedence) · CPC title
Transmitting camera control signals through networks, e.g. control via the Internet · CPC title
Related publications grouped by family.
Answers are generated from the same data shown on this page.